Chinese pop star set on fire in cafe after dispute with friend
WARNING - GRAPHIC CONTENT: A Chinese pop star can be seen running down a set of stairs completely engulfed by flames in a disturbing video that has emerged online.
Tang Anqi arrived at the Shanghai Boashan Wanda café at 7pm on March 1 and within one hour, her body was on fire, People’s Daily reports.
The singer suffered burns to 80 per cent of her body following a dispute with a friend inside at a cafe.
The star's friend and the manager of the cafe both said Tang wasn’t in the best mood on the night.
"She [Tang] was quite aggressive and in a bad mood,” the café's manager said.
According to reports, a staff member took a chocolate cake to the table and Tang refused it, saying it was “ugly".
Not long after the rude remark, the star ran down the stairs, screaming for help and completely engulfed in flames.
Authorities believe the 23-year-old had a dispute with her friend and a lighter was what “accidentally” set the girl on fire.
“She seemed to be fiddling with the lighter then. But none of us know what exactly took place as the staffers were all on the first floor of the store while the woman and her friend was staying on the second floor,” director of the cafe, Wen, told Shanghai Daily.
The restaurant's manager said Tang was wearing stockings, which is what caused the fire to spread so quickly up her body.
He tried to help her before calling emergency services, then she was taken to ICU at the Changhai Hospital of Shanghai.
A doctor told the publication that Tang has woken up and she is currently not in danger.
The table where Tang was sitting was a in a corner and a blind spot to security cameras, so the moment she was set on fire was not able to be captured.
Tang’s friend has not been identified and the incident is under investigation.
The café posted a statement on social media page explaining the incident:
"A girl set on fire when inside the café, it only took a few seconds for the flames to spread from her hair to her body. The staff and emergency services responded as quickly as they could.”
Tang is a member of popular Chinese idol girl group, SNH48 and joined the group in 2012.
The group sings, dances and perform in theatres across China and Japan.
